MySQL的OF是关键字吗?
在MySQL中,关键字是指被数据库系统保留用来执行特定功能或操作的单词或标识符。这些关键字在SQL语句中具有特殊的含义,不能用作标识符或变量名。那么,OF是MySQL中的关键字吗?我们来详细探讨一下。
OF不是MySQL的关键字
根据MySQL的官方文档,在MySQL中,并没有将OF作为关键字来定义和使用。OF通常是用作ORDER BY子句中表示排序规则的一部分。例如,当我们要按照某个字段进行降序排序时,可以使用DESC代表降序,而DESC并非是一个关键字,而是一个表示排序规则的关键词。
示例说明
让我们通过一个简单的示例来说明OF在MySQL中并不是一个关键字。假设我们有一个名为students的表格,其中包含学生的信息,如学生id、姓名和分数等字段。我们希望查询所有学生的信息,并按照分数进行降序排序。
SELECT * FROM students ORDER BY score DESC;
在这个例子中,DESC是表示降序排序的关键词,而OF并没有被用作关键字的一部分。因此,OF不是MySQL中的关键字。
流程图
让我们通过一个流程图来展示如何在MySQL中进行按分数降序排序的操作。
flowchart TD
A(开始) --> B(查询所有学生信息)
B --> C(按照分数降序排序)
C --> D(显示排序后的结果)
D --> E(结束)
通过以上流程图可以清晰地看到在MySQL中进行排序操作的步骤。
序列图
接下来,让我们通过一个序列图来展示在MySQL中查询并排序的具体过程。
sequenceDiagram
participant Client
participant MySQL
Client ->> MySQL: 查询所有学生信息
MySQL -->> Client: 返回学生信息
Client ->> MySQL: 按照分数降序排序
MySQL -->> Client: 返回排序后的结果
以上序列图展示了客户端与MySQL数据库之间进行查询和排序操作的交互过程。
结论
综上所述,OF并不是MySQL中的关键字,而是用作ORDER BY子句中表示排序规则的一部分。在MySQL中,关键字的作用是执行特定的操作或功能,而OF仅仅是一个表示排序规则的关键词。在编写SQL语句时,我们应该注意区分关键字和关键词的使用,以确保语句的准确性和合法性。希望本文能够帮助您更好地理解MySQL中的关键字和关键词的使用。